A law firm in Los Angeles, CA is seeking a dedicated Immigration Attorney with 1-4 years of experience to join their dynamic team. Reporting to the Sr. Associate Attorney, the successful candidate will manage a diverse caseload, interact with clients, and collaborate with the firm's Immigration Team. The role involves representing clients in various immigration proceedings, preparing and reviewing immigration applications, and developing strategic legal solutions. Bilingual candidates (Spanish) are preferred.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Report to the Sr. Associate Attorney while managing a personal caseload and client interactions.
  • Collaborate with the Immigration Team of Attorneys and legal assistants.
  • Explain immigration concepts and provide strategic solutions for clients.
  • Represent non-detained and detained individuals in removal proceedings before the Immigration Court and Board of Immigration Appeals.
  • Visit detention centers to conduct intake interviews with detained individuals.
  • Prepare a variety of immigration applications, including removal defense and family-based petitions.
  • Review and make necessary adjustments to immigration applications and packets.
  • Engage with law enforcement, prosecutorial offices, and community-based organizations regarding changes in immigration law.
  • Meet with potential clients for strategic consultations and develop necessary case strategies.
  • Prepare clients and witnesses for court and USCIS testimony, including developing legal strategies.
  • Provide legal analysis to determine potential benefits for clients' cases.
  • Prepare and submit legal briefs for a range of immigration cases.
  • Demonstrate high interpersonal skills and a record of moving legal cases forward.
  • Experience with Family-Based Petitions, Humanitarian relief, EOIR (Executive Office for Immigration Review), Detained cases, Citizenship, and other USCIS applications is required.
